How they compare
Belize currently reports 283.06 against 244.67 in Iceland, a difference of 38.39.
That makes Belize's figure about 1.2 times Iceland's.
Across all 23 years both countries report, Belize has been ahead every year.
Belize ranks 100th and Iceland ranks 102nd of 219 countries.
Belize has averaged higher in every one of the 3 decades both report.
